Ok I’m being so brave about it but a couple of days ago I saw this post claiming that the Jedi saying ‘this weapon [your lightsaber] is your life’ is emblematic of ‘the Jedi’s failure as peacekeepers’ (not an exact quote but pretty close) because why would a weapon be the life of a peacekeeper?
And like. The Jedi are a culture. They’re a religion.
You know that, right? You know that many cultures, including generally peaceful ones, have sacred weapons, right? You know that the bond between a Jedi and their crystal(s) is an extremely sacred thing that requires the consent of both parties and is integral to their way of life, right?
You know that lightsabers are not intended to be only for killing, right? That the first thing Luke learns to do with his lightsaber is to shield and defend? You know that a culture having sacred weapons doesn’t mean that they view killing as sacred, right?

i’ve never understood the idea that the jedi arrogantly refused to believe the dark side was rising in the prequels/clone wars. that is just… so blatantly not what we see
when qui-gon first brings it up in the phantom menace they don’t really believe it, sure, mostly because to their knowledge they haven’t seen a sith lord in a millennia, so it is a wild idea. this initial denial has consequences, sure, but it’s hardly the all-encompassing arrogance that people accuse them of.
and then at the end of the very same movie the question is literally posed OUT LOUD if they killed the master or apprentice- they know there’s another out there!!! the problem is they just don’t have the slightest idea on where to look first, especially with palpatine clouding their vision with the dark side.
then they also have a hard time believing initially that dooku is a sith- not because they don’t think there’s a sith around, but because they KNOW dooku, loved and trusted him even, and are having a hard time believing he’d do such terrible things. but once they see it for themselves, they do fully acknowledge that dooku is a sith and has fallen to the dark side.
the jedi KNOW by the end of tpm that the dark side is rising in power. they KNOW that there are sith around. they’re not denying anything, and are actively even working against it, but their vision is being intentionally clouded by a bad faith actor.
they are just struggling to put the pieces together and figure out the best way to handle it (while also dealing with every other problem the galaxy has that gets put on their shoulders and eventually a whole ass WAR), and unfortunately, once they figure it all out it’s too late.

God I’m just thinking. And ugh, the Jedi’s martial arts must have been amazing. They had seven distinct styles, passed down over a thousand generations, by uncountable lineages.
Every lineage must have had their own katas, their own training methods and distinct variations on the forms. There were probably inter-lineage feuds on what type of sparring they taught, variations on specific katas, which techniques were acceptable in sparring, anything. You KNOW those High Republic Outpost Jedi must have created new styles that were gradually subsumed into the 7 forms.
What would a Jedi Tournament have looked like? Were there ones for specific forms, like Soresu-only competitions? Did they have some kind of point sparring? Was there an endurance/blocking division? How would they have measured Force abilities in a tournament setting? How did they score?
